On the morning of Sunday, September 28th, GOB Menorca’s Custòdia Agrària programm is organizing a very special excursion in which the joy of music, the appreciation of the landscape and the pleasure of tasting agroecological products will come together in an incomparable experience. OCIM, the Illa de Menorca Chamber Orchestra, under the artistic direction of Francesc Prat, will offer a concert bringing one of the jewels of musical classicism to the traditional era at Santa Cecília farm, located in Ferreries.

At Santa Cecília, OCIM will perform one of the earliest and most representative orchestral works by Joseph Haydn, Morning, which together with Noon and Evening forms a trilogy. The event is part of a musical weekend in which the Orchestra will perform the three parts of The Times of Day in unique settings across the island.

Today, a new collaborative track has been released on all digital platforms to denounce the problem of tourism saturation affecting Menorca. It’s a song created four-handedly, with the involvement of various Menorcan musicians, born from a will to denounce, but also to reach a broad audience without giving up its festive nature.
